![240](https://upload.jianshu.io/users/upload_avatars/23728960/eb33d7c2-0cc9-4a24-b8a8-03dd88c51553.jpeg?imageMogr2/auto-orient/strip|imageView2/1/w/240/h/240)
線程池概述 多線程可以最大限度地發(fā)揮多核CPU的計算能力篓足,提高生產(chǎn)系統(tǒng)的吞吐量和性能枢希,但也會帶來一些問題响鹃,比如:線程數(shù)量過大可能耗盡CPU資源;...
概述 在進行消費端服務調(diào)用的時候,看到初始化了LoadBalance,通過負載均衡獲取一個可用的節(jié)點。LoadBalance也是一個擴展點旨涝,Du...
概述 上文消費端服務調(diào)用中描述了發(fā)起一次遠程調(diào)用的調(diào)用鏈,解析到了觸發(fā)了Netty的outBound寫事件writeAndFlush侣背,將請求編碼...
架構圖 不貼架構圖的源碼分析沒有靈魂白华,所以,架構圖在此秃踩。不過個人感覺衬鱼,架構圖的作用在于源碼看的七七八八的時候,通過架構圖將其串成一個整體憔杨,并理解...
Dubbo協(xié)議解析 Dubbo協(xié)議設計參考了TCP/IP協(xié)議鸟赫,包括協(xié)議頭和協(xié)議體兩部分。16字節(jié)報文頭主要攜帶了魔法數(shù)(0xdabb消别,用于分割兩...
ReferenceBean簡述 每個ServiceBean表示一個生產(chǎn)者抛蚤,對應的每個ReferenceBean都表示一個消費者,Referenc...
概述 Netty的網(wǎng)絡操作都是異步的寻狂,在前面Netty的源碼分析中看到岁经,Netty使用了大量的異步回調(diào)處理模式,經(jīng)常會看到返回一個Channel...
概述 上面幾篇文章中會經(jīng)成呷看到執(zhí)行到某個地方缀壤,然后就開始在ChannelPipeline傳播事件,再由ChannelPipeline責任鏈上的一...
ServiceBean概述 ServiceBean是Dubbo中很重要的一個類纠亚,每個暴露出去的服務都會生成一個ServiceBean塘慕,Servi...